7 Reasons Why Your Business Should Consider VoIP

1 ✓ Business Continuity
With VoIP based communications they allow businesses to incorporate continuity options. In the case of a disastrous events such as fires or floods, your call data and information is stored safely, not to mention to the the fact that your phones are hosted outside the premises, means you would still have functioning telephony. Calls incoming to the business can be transferred to an alternative number, for example you might have business mobiles, again providing you with complete business continuity option in the event that problem occurs, (Great For Small Businesses).
2 ✓ Remote & Flexible Work Opportunities
The concept of remote working is a ever growing factor, however employees do still need to remain contactable and connected to the organisation. VoIP systems allow employees to be allocated a virtual phone number, for example calls will be forwarded to the employees phone and they'll appear as they are sitting in the office, easy and simple, (Great For Small Businesses).
3 ✓ Scalability Benefits
Businesses naturally grow and shrink as the years go by. VoIP systems function on a peer to seat basis. You can speedily add or remove new people to the businesses when they come or go. Meaning your telephony can scale up or down as your business sees fit, (Great For Small Businesses). With VoIP & Cloud, telephone system maintenance is all included.
4 ✓ Capital Saving
When it comes to internal calls (peer to peer) they can be very costly, however what can be more detrimental to a business is ineffective communication systems. With VoIP systems, they negate the need for paying for internal calls. This mean whether your are in the same building or a different office, you are able to call your peer at no cost (Great For Small Businesses).
5 ✓ Great Audio Quality
VoIP systems will use up much more bandwidth compared to a traditional telephone systems, but VoIP delivers better quality audio, this is refereed to as HD telephony. VoIP gives your business HD clearer and crisper sound quality. Maybe you are a hotel, call center or general practice, call quality is vital to your organisation.
6 ✓ Easy To Upgrade
There is no need to pay anyone to upgrade your telephone system. You are able to incorporate the same system hosted in the cloud to receive upgrades. Your business does not need to worry about upgrading telephony systems, (Great For Small Businesses).
7 ✓ Conferencing Options
VoIP can use collaborative features, allowing your business to hold conferences with clients or internal staff without having them in the same room. Of course this can negate the need in some cases to travel to another premises for meetings, which can help improve productivity and save costs in the long run, (Great For Small Businesses).
